Asaram's journey from 'Godman' to guilty
Self-styled godman Asaram Bapu was found guilty in a 2013 rape case by Jodhpur Scheduled Caste and Scheduled Tribe Court, on Wednesday.
He has been convicted for raping a minor girl in Manai village near Jodhpur on August 15, 2013.
He is lodged in Jodhpur Central jail.
Asaram's spokesperson Neelam Dubey said they will talk to their legal team and decide future course of action.
"We will discuss with our legal team and then decide our future course of action. We have confidence in our judiciary," Dubey said.
Earlier in the day, people were seen offering prayers at the godman's ashram in Madhya Pradesh's Bhopal, Uttar Pradesh's Varanasi, Gujarat's Ahmedabad and Punjab's Ludhiana for his acquittal.
A follower of Asaram even reached the jail with a garland in the morning. He, however, was detained by police.
